Frequently Asked Questions
Q
What is the rated voltage of the KYN28-12 withdrawable armored metal-enclosed switchgear?
The KYN28-12 switchgear has a rated voltage of 12 kV, making it suitable for medium-voltage indoor power distribution systems.
Q
What types of operating mechanisms are available for this switchgear?
Two types of operating mechanisms are available: D (Electromagnetic) and T (Spring). The choice depends on the application's control and automation requirements.
Q
What is the enclosure protection class of the KYN28-12 switchgear?
The KYN28-12 switchgear enclosure meets IP4X protection class, providing protection against solid objects greater than 1mm in diameter and suitable for indoor installations.
Q
What rated current options are available for the main bus?
The main bus rated current options include 630A, 1250A, 1600A, 2000A, 2500A, and 3150A, providing flexibility for various power distribution needs.
Q
What information needs to be provided when placing an order for KYN28-12 switchgear?
When ordering, customers should provide product ordering drawings including wiring diagrams, transformer capacity, main component model specifications, distribution branch circuits and capacity, metering and compensation device requirements, compensation capacitor capacity, and surface treatment requirements.
Q
What are the main compartments of the KYN28-12 switchgear?
The KYN28-12 switchgear is divided into four main compartments: A (Busbar Compartment), B (Circuit Breaker Compartment), C (Cable Compartment), and D (Instrument Compartment), each serving a distinct function to ensure safe and efficient operation.
